Before uranium goes into a reactor, it must undergo four major processing steps to take it from its raw state to usable nuclear fuel: mining and milling, conversion, enrichment and fuel fabrication. First, uranium is mined with conventional methods or by insitu leach mining, where carbonated water is shot into underground deposits and piped up to the surface.

Mining and Processing Uranium Ore Uranium is found in deposits in various locations throughout the world, Canada, Australia and Kazakhstan being at the forefront of mining operations. Once deposits of uranium ore have been located using surveys such as geophysical and geochemical analyses, it is mined in the conventional manner from the seams of uranium ore.
After mining, uranium ore is processed into yellowcake, a type of uranium concentrate powder obtained from leach solutions. Yellowcake is then converted into a form that can be enriched to fuel grade concentration, and ultimately fabricated into fuel rod assemblies for electrical generation.

Jul 15, 2019· Developing the ore deposit into usable uranium would have involved mining, milling and tailings management. Specifically, following the extraction, the uranium ore would be milled, meaning it would be processed into a usable form by separating the pure uranium from the tailings, which are a waste byproduct of the milling process.
